Jacksboro had already proven themselves in the regular season and they didn't miss a beat now that it's playoff time. They had just enough and edged the Clyde Bulldogs out 11-10. Jacksboro's victory was all the more impressive since Clyde was averaging only 3.67 runs allowed on the season.
Brailyn Tullous was a standout: she scored a run and stole a base while going 3-for-5. The team also got some help courtesy of Kylie Tullous, who scored three runs while going 3-for-5.
On Clyde's side, they got a massive performance out of Maycee Wilson, who went 3-for-3 with five RBI and three doubles. Sutton McClain was another key contributor, firing off two home runs while going 2-for-4.
Jacksboro has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 24 of their last 26 matches, which provided a nice bump to their 31-5 record this season. As for Clyde, their defeat ended a five-game streak of away wins and brought them to 27-6.
The teams didn't have to wait long for a rematch: Jacksboro beat Clyde by a score of 7-4.
